Sutton-on-Sea lies between Mablethorpe and Skegness and offers the prospect of a quiet break by the coast, with a lovely blue flag beach to enjoy. The village itself is fairly quiet with some fine traditional stone buildings, although it does have a district called Miami Beach!

The landscape has changed significantly down the years, with remains of the ancient forest occasionally visible at low tide.

Visitors can also enjoy some inland sightseeing in the fine scenery of the Lincolnshire Wolds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, with its rolling hills and lush valleys, woodland, grassland and abandoned chalk pits.

Lincoln, with its towering cathedral, is also well within range.
